Traditional folk song, given a very English treatment from an Irish source.
The tune and text come from Robert Cinnamond of Co Antrim, but the style is pure East Anglian pub session. Suffolk and Norfolk still have such places and the licencing officers haven't found us yet! This is one of the songs that gets them all singing.
Mary Humphreys - vocal; Anahata - 1 row Hohner melodeon in C, chorus
